On November 02, 2000 at 20:27:34, Robert Hyatt wrote: >On November 02, 2000 at 20:08:57, Ricardo Gibert wrote: > >>[D]8/1R3p2/4pkp1/7p/7P/5PP1/r7/6K1 w - - 10 46 >> >>Why doesn't White play 46.f4 here? > > >What is the issue? IE it appears to be drawn no matter what happens unless >white drops material... 3 vs 2 is a dead draw. 4 vs 3 is much harder, and used to be thought to be winning. It is now thought to be drawn, but there is room to make mistakes. Kasparov played it out and was right to do so. I saw some analysis that leads me to believe that he thinks he missed a win. bruce
